TO BELONG Primary School Music Resource – “Musicians performing at Values for Life (V4L) School Seminars have created a number of songs which relate strongly to the values and themes being presented in the sessions delivered to students. A special selection of those songs has been compiled on this CD in response to a lot of interest shown in recent years from primary school teachers wanting to enhance their teaching and learning programs for regular classes when addressing values for living. This material provides a way to engage students with an even wider range of learning styles than would be possible through the rich activities, discussions, information and personal experience which is compressed into the V4L School Seminar sessions. The booklet, accompanying the CD (to belong), is arranged so that teachers are provided with leading questions and prompts for class discussion on the theme or values on which they wish to focus with their students.”
